What does IT operation and maintenance include?

The so-called IT operation and maintenance management refers to the comprehensive management of IT such as hard operating environment (software environment, network environment, etc.). ), the IT business system and IT operation and maintenance personnel are in charge of the IT department of the unit.

IT operation and maintenance management mainly includes eight aspects:

1 equipment management.

Monitor and manage the running status of network devices, server devices and operating systems.

2 application services.

Monitor and manage all kinds of application support software, such as database, middleware, groupware and all kinds of general or special services, such as email system, DNS, Web, etc.

3 data storage.

Unified storage, backup and recovery of system and business data.

4 business.

Including the monitoring and management of the operation of the enterprise's own core business system. For business management, we mainly focus on CSF (key success factor) and KPI (key performance indicator) of business system.

5 directory content.

This part is mainly about the content management and public information management that enterprises need to publish uniformly or customize for people.

6 resource assets.

Managing the resource assets of IT system in an enterprise can be physical or logical, and can interact with the financial department of the enterprise.

7 information security.

The international standard of information security management is ISO 17799, which covers ten control aspects, 36 control objectives and 127 control methods of information security management, such as enterprise security organization, asset classification and control, personnel safety, physical and environmental safety, communication and operation safety, access control and business continuity management.

8 daily work.

This part is mainly used to standardize and clarify the job responsibilities and work arrangements of operation and maintenance personnel, provide quantitative basis for performance appraisal, and provide a means to accumulate and enjoy experience and knowledge.
